Zircon U-Pb Geochronology of the Taohuacun Porphyry, Middle Part of the Jinshajiang-Ailaoshan Shear Zone, and Its Geological Significance

The Taohuacun porphyry is located at the middle part of the Jinshajiang-Ailaoshan alkaline-rich porphyry belt.In this paper,the Jianchuanbei porphyry is studied by means of petrography,U-Pb geochronology and rare earth element(REE) of zircons.Petrography study reveals that there are clinopyroxene in thin section,suggesting some special petrogenetic information.The zircon U-Pb geochronology indicates that the age of the Taohuacun porphyry is 35.9 Ma±0.5 Ma(MSWD=2.2,n=14),agree with the age of Cenozoic alkaline-rich porphyry in Jianchuan-Beiya area,and synchronous with most of the porphyry within the Jinshajiang-Ailaoshan alkaline-rich porphyry belt as well.Together with other geological evidence,it is believed that the petrogenesis of the Taohuacun porphyry was closely related to the strike-slip movements caused by Indo-Euroasia collision,and may have significant contributions from the mantle.
